Output 52d901b535c776b859a12a35a023cc14136988860114846b3d376da29e952450:4

value
158672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10a92d220635e406a3071c0f60dbe6bef6bad6f OP_EQUAL
address
3LkKpJCHgieZj4YY9oCyDpBuH9be5yBkta
transaction
52d901b535c776b859a12a35a023cc14136988860114846b3d376da29e952450